Stratum-1 HOWTO tickless confusion

Achim Gratz Stromeko at nexgo.de
Sun Jan 29 15:43:50 UTC 2017


The Stratum-1 HOWTO needlessly confuses tickless operation with the
opposite: "An optimization that is convenient to apply at this point is
telling the kernel to run tickless[…]".  The standard kernel is running
tickless by default and switches off the scheduling tick when all CPU
become idle.  The kernel option "nohz=off" is not telling the kernel to
run tickless, instead it will instruct the kernel to run the scheduler
tick even on an otherwise idle system.

As a side remark, I think it would be much better if ntpd just set up
it's own timer if it expects a regular tick.  Similar changes should
probably be applied to the hardPPS code in the kernel (which currently
doesn't compile on tickless kernels).  If hardPPS would work on tickless
kernels then the need for regular ticks waking up ntpd might perhaps
even vanish.


Regards,
Achim.
-- 
+<[Q+ Matrix-12 WAVE#46+305 Neuron microQkb Andromeda XTk Blofeld]>+

Factory and User Sound Singles for Waldorf rackAttack:
http://Synth.Stromeko.net/Downloads.html#WaldorfSounds



More information about the devel mailing list